How to gain your qualification faster

Recognition of Prior learning (RPL) is “the acknowledgement of the skills and knowledge” that you have gained through previous studies, work and life experiences. If RPL is granted, this will mean that you will not have to complete the study or assessments for a unit or units of competency.

How long does the course take?

Duration: 24 months Location: Metropolitan & Remote sites Trainee/Instructor Ratio: Max 10:1
